2018-19 (JUNIOR):
Played in and started all 26 games for the Gorloks in 2018-19 ... Was the only Gorlok to play in and start every game last season ... Was the team's leader in minutes played with 721 and averaged 27.7 minutes per game ... Second on the team in points scored (268) and was third in scoring average (10.3) ... One of three players to average double figures in scoring in 2018-19 ... Averaged 10.3 points, 3.0 rebounds, 3.8 assists and 3.2 steals per game ... Led team in assists (98) and steals (84) ... Her 98 assists were tied for fifth on the school's single season chart, while the 84 steals were tied for third on the school's single season chart ... Enters the 2019-20 season sitting third in career steals with 199 and needs 59 steals to break the school's career mark of 258 held by Laura Stuhlman (1998-02) ... Needs just 303 points to become the seventh Gorlok player to score 1,000 career points ... Scored in double figures in 13 games, including tying a career high with 19 points against both Belhaven (11/16) and Blackburn (2/9) ... Earned Second-Team All-SLIAC honors and was also named to the SLIAC All-Defensive Team ... Recorded at least one steal in 24 of Webster's 26 games, including collecting four or more steals in 11 games ... Had a career high seven steals at Principia (2/12) and those seven steals were tied for ninth most in a game in school history ... Dished out an assist in all 26 games and enters the season having recorded at least one assist in 27 consecutive games dating to the Westminster game in the finals of the 2018 SLIAC Tournament ... Recorded five or more assists in a game eight times, including tying a career high with seven assists at both Fontbonne (11/28) and at Covenant (12/8) ... Those seven assists were tied for 19th most on the school's single game chart ... Pulled down 79 rebounds, which was fifth on the team ... Had four or more rebounds in a game 10 times, including a season high six boards on three different occasions ... Blocked five shots ... Posted a 1.1 assist/turnover ratio ... Shot 42 percent from the field and 25 percent (16-for-64) from the 3-point line ... Her 16 made 3-pointers were third most on the team ... Made 95 field goals, which was second most on the team ... Her 79.5 free throw percentage was tops on the team ... Her 62 made free throws were tied for second on the team, while her 78 free throw attempts were third on the team ... Shot five or more free throws six times, including a season high eight attempts (made six) at Eureka (2/2) ... Played 30 or more minutes in nine games, including two 40-plus minute games as she tallied 42 minutes against Spalding (1/30) and 43 minutes at Greenville (2/21) in the semifinals of the SLIAC Tournament ... Saw action in and started all 16 SLIAC games ... Averaged 11.2 points, 3.3 rebounds, 3.9 assists and 2.9 steals per game in SLIAC play ... Shot 47 percent from the field, 30 percent from the 3-point line and 82 percent from the free throw line against league foes.

2017-18 (SOPHOMORE): Played in all 27 games and made two starts for the Gorloks in 2017-18 ... Fourth on the team in scoring with 226 points and averaged 8.4 points per game ... Was third on team in assists (56), fourth in steals (53) and fifth in rebounds (72) ... Scored in double figures in 10 games, including a season-high 16 points against Spalding (2/8) ... Had five or more rebounds in a game three times, including tying a career high with seven boards against Ripon (11/18) ... Dished out three or more assists in seven games, including a career high seven assists against Ripon (11/18) ... Recorded at least two steals in 19 of her 27 games she played and had a season high four steals three different times ... Blocked six shots on the year, including a career-high two blocks at Fontbonne (1/27) ... Posted a 1.0 assist/turnover ratio ... Shot 47 percent from the field and 31 percent (12-for-39) from the 3-point line ... Her 86.5 free throw percentage was tops on the team ... Opened the season hitting her first 22 free throws attempts ... Played 20 or more minutes in eight games, including a season high 23 minutes against both Spalding (2/8) and Eureka (2/23). 

2016-17 (FRESHMAN): Saw action in all 26 games and averaged 16.5 minutes per game ... Tallied 203 points, 70 rebounds, 34 assists and 62 steals on the season ... The 62 steals, which led the team, is 17th on the school's single season chart ... Scored in double figures in 11 games, including a career-high 19 points at MacMurray (1/16) ... On the season, averaged 7.8 points, 2.7 rebounds, 1.3 assists and 2.4 steals per game ... Had three or more rebounds in a game seven times, including a career-high tying seven boards against MacMurray (2/15) ... Dished out two or more assists in eight games, including a season high five against Fontbonne (2/18) ... Posted an 0.7 assist/turnover ratio ... Recorded two or more steals in 18 of 26 games, including a career-high six steals against Greenville (11/30) ... Blocked three shots on the year ... Shot 38 percent from the field and hit nine treys ... Connected on 80 percent of her free throws (52-for-65) ... Played 20 or more minutes in a game four times, including a career high 29 minutes against Greenville (11/30).

HIGH SCHOOL: Was a four-year varsity letterwinner in basketball at Twin River High School for Coach Kelly Westerfield ... Was a two-time All-Conference, All-District and All-State selection as both a junior and senior ... As a senior, earned the Team's Defensive Award and led the team in points (431), steals (129) and assists (59) ... Set the school's single season scoring record of 442 points as a junior ... During her junior year, she also led the team in assists with 36 and shot 48.9 percent from the field ... Earned Team MVP honors in basketball as a sophomore and junior ... Was also a four-year letterwinner in softball ... Earned All-Conference honors in softball as a junior and senior and was an All-District selection as a sophomore and junior ... In the classroom, was a 2015 Softball Academic All-State selection ... Played AAU Basketball for Don Osborn and Southeast Dynasty for two years.
